728x90 데이터베이스 뷰2 [ORACLE] ALL_ALL_TABLES 뷰 완벽 해설 및 실무 활용 가이드 Oracle 데이터베이스는 방대한 양의 메타데이터를 다양한 시스템 뷰를 통해 제공합니다. 그중 ALL_ALL_TABLES 뷰는 현재 사용자(User)가 접근 가능한 모든 테이블의 정보를 확인할 수 있는 매우 유용한 데이터 딕셔너리 뷰입니다.1. ALL_ALL_TABLES란?ALL_ALL_TABLES는 오라클에서 제공하는 데이터 딕셔너리 뷰 중 하나로, 사용자가 직접 소유하거나, 권한이 부여된 테이블들의 구조 및 속성 정보를 제공합니다. 즉, 단순히 사용자 소유의 테이블만 보여주는 USER_ALL_TABLES와 달리, 이 뷰는 권한을 통해 접근할 수 있는 타 사용자의 테이블도 함께 보여줍니다.2. 주요 컬럼 설명ALL_ALL_TABLES 뷰는 수십 개의 컬럼을 제공하지만, 실무에서 자주 사용하는 주요 컬럼.. 2025. 6. 17. [ORACLE] ALL_VIEWS 뷰 사용법과 실무 활용 전략 Oracle Database에서 View(뷰)는 복잡한 쿼리를 캡슐화하고 데이터 보안을 강화하기 위한 중요한 수단입니다. 뷰는 테이블과 달리 실제 데이터를 저장하지 않으며, SQL 문을 기반으로 하는 가상의 테이블입니다. Oracle에서는 이 뷰(View)들에 대한 정의와 메타데이터를 확인할 수 있도록 ALL_VIEWS라는 시스템 뷰를 제공합니다.1. ALL_VIEWS란 무엇인가?ALL_VIEWS는 사용자가 접근 권한을 가진 모든 뷰에 대한 정의 정보를 제공하는 Oracle 시스템 뷰입니다. 즉, 자신이 소유하거나 권한이 부여된 뷰에 대한 SQL 정의문을 포함하며, 뷰를 분석하거나 변경하려는 상황에서 유용하게 사용됩니다.2. 주요 컬럼 설명ALL_VIEWS에서 자주 활용되는 주요 컬럼은 다음과 같습니다:.. 2025. 6. 15. 이전 1 다음 728x90